The specificity of OLR1 Monoclonal Antibody (CSB0036) was tested on the Membrane Proteome Array™ and shown to be specific for OLR1. The Membrane Proteome Array™ contains 6,000 different human membrane proteins, each expressed in unfixed human cells to ensure native conformation and post-translational modifications. OLR1 is a single-pass transmembrane protein and low density lipoprotein receptor with a secreted form. OLR1 is part of the C-type lectin superfamily. OLR1 is responsible for binding, internalizing, and degrading oxidatively modified low density lipoprotein (oxLDL) and possibly regulates Fas-induced apoptosis. Mutations in OLR1 are associated with atherosclerosis and myocardial infarction risk and may be related to Alzheimer’s disease risk.
